Yes, it is possible to convert Bitlocker encrypted GPT drive to MBR. Bitlocker, a technology first used in Windows Vista, provides full-volume encryption that can help add an extra layer of security to your storage devices, including internal and external hard drives and removable devices. Thus, if you want to convert Bitlocker encrypted GPT drive to MBR, you need first to remove the Bitlocker encryption. Next, We will show you the details about removing Bitlocker encryption and converting the drive to MBR.

After turning off the Bitlocker encryption, you can continue with the disk conversion process.
Convert GPT to MBR
Diskpart of Windows can convert between MBR and GPT, but it will erase your data and cause many problems. If you fear this built-in utility will damage your important data, use a reliable third-party tool.
